- Biography/History:
- Hyung Wook Park is a historian based in Singapore. He has extensively studied the histories of biomedical research, evolutionary ideas, and the science-religion interfaces. His papers include "Science, State, and Spirituality" (2018). Along with Ronald Numbers, Park edited "Creationism in Asia, Oceania, and Eastern Europe" (2021).
